R600: Use legacy (0 * anything = 0) MUL instructions for pow intrinsics
Fixes wrong lighting in some corner cases with r600g and radeonsi, e.g.
manifested by failure of two piglit/glean tests and intermittent black
patches in many apps.
Tested on SI and RS880.
